Breaking: Wife of NSCDC’s top officer regains freedom

The kidnapped wife of the Head, Commandant General’s Special Intelligence Squad (CG’SSIS), DCC Appollos Dandaura, Mrs Dandaura Victoria Apollos, who was taken away forcefully inside her living room has been rescued at about 9.20 pm Friday evening, in Lafia, Nassarawa State.

According to a statement signed by the Corps spokesman, Olusola Odumosu, the woman was rescued unhurt after a successful joint operations by a combined tactical component comprising of the Commandant General’s Special Intelligence Squad (CG’S SIS), NSCDC Counter Terrorism Operatives (CTU) and NSCDC Special Female Squad (SFS) in collaboration with the Nigerian Army (NA), Department of State Services (DSS) and the Nigeria Police Force (NPF).

Recall that Mrs Dandaura Victoria was kidnapped at her residence in Gidi-Gidi, around Cattle market, Lafia, Nasarawa State on Wednesday, 2nd November, 2022 at about 7pm in the evening by unknown gun men who stomed his residence and were shooting sporadically in the air before whisking her away forcefully at gun point.

“His younger brother, ASC1 Ezekiel Dandaura Samu, a personnel of the Corps serving in Nasarawa State Command who sustained gunshot injuries in the cause of the attack is still receiving treatment in a hospital facility and is in a stable condition. 

“The Commandant General, NSCDC, Ahmed Abubakar Audi, PhD, mni, OFR wishes to appreciate the efforts, maximum support and cooperation sister security agencies rendered in this rescue operation.”
